text: The National Lacrosse Association was a professional box lacrosse league that operated in 1968–1969 with teams from both the United States and Canada. Due to poor attendance, the league folded in March 1969. After the folding, two teams joined the ill-fated Eastern Professional Lacrosse League which went defunct after one season.
